moesyk4 Posted January 27, 2014 #7 Share Posted January 27, 2014 We chose against Peat Taylor because I had heard his private tours are not necessarily private as in your own group. When we were in port, we passed his bus which had at least 30 people on board. If you were looking at doing your own thing, I"m sure he could arrange it. Anyway, we took Courtney Taylor and primarily did the beach...we had a 4 year old and 2 pregnant ladies so most of the touristy stuff was off limits. We did a short river tubing expedition first which was fantastic and then went to Bamboo Blu Beach. I was very, very happy with this beach, primarily because I had heard Jamaica is one of the worst as far as vendors go, and I HATE that while trying to relax. This beach appears to be privately owned (we had to go into a gate community next to the RIU to get there) and so there is only one person there selling massages. They asked once and then left us alone. The beach is not terribly huge but is also not busy at all. There appeared to be chairs for rent and also a few tented bed type areas. There is also a sit downish restaurant in the middle and very nice bathrooms. We spent about 2 hours there, which is usually plenty of time for me at the beach, but we wanted to stay longer at the end. The water was very clear and not rocky at all. Lady Anna & Sir Troy Posted February 14, 2014 #8 Share Posted February 14, 2014 I used Peat Taylor Tour without any issues. Peat Jr. only took our group of 5 and we went to Coyaba Water Garden and the Blue Hole. He also stopped at a grocery store for us and was very friendly. We had a great day. While we were at Coyaba he shuttled another group to Dunns River and was back for us at the end of the tour. We knew that upfront and there were no issues - he was right on time!! We did not go to the Beach with him so I can't comment on that. L.A.S.T.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
